[nb-NO]Title[nb-NO]Lacquer hard pillow with double phoenix and double dragon designs on ends
[nb-NO]Description[nb-NO]The pillows are made of a pliant material, probably bamboo, on which a thick layer of red lacquer is applied. The construction is essentially a hollow rectangular box with its longer edges bent into a gradual concave curve for resting the neck.
There are illustrations of dragons on one end of the pillows and phoenixes on the other.
(NUS Baba House, Architecture and Artefacts of a Straits Chinese Home, Page 103)
